The Promaster Multicoated UV Polarizer 62mm Filter is a high-quality optical accessory designed to enhance your photography experience. This filter is crafted with precision, featuring a 62mm diameter that is compatible with a wide range of lenses.
The standout feature of this filter is its multicoating, which significantly reduces reflections, glare, and lens flare. This allows for clearer and more vibrant images, especially in high contrast situations. The UV filter also protects your lens from harm, shielding it from dust, dirt, and scratches.
The filter's primary function is to act as a polarizer, which helps to eliminate reflections off water, glass, and other surfaces. This can result in a more saturated and true-to-life color representation in your images. The polarizer also reduces haze and improves contrast, making it an excellent tool for landscape and nature photography.
The Promaster Multicoated UV Polarizer 62mm Filter is constructed using high-quality optics, ensuring sharpness and clarity across the entire image. It is also made to be durable, with a sturdy filter ring that is easy to attach and detach.
